W.A. Shewhart wrote a hundred years ago to his bosses:
“A few days ago, you mentioned some of the problems connected with the development of an acceptable form of inspection report which might be modified from time to time, in order to give at a glance the greatest amount of accurate information…… Should it be found desirable, however, to make use of this form of chart in any of the studies now being conducted within the Inspection Department, it will be possible to indicate the method to be followed in the particular examples.”
"Walter Shewhart developed a critical insight that, while all processes exhibit variation, some variation is inherent to the specific process. From this thinking, he invented the Statistical Process Control (SPC) technique in 1924."
The first control chart was “born”! The QIS will be holding a “birthday party” to celebrate this significant event. There will be three talks and a discussion.
